Is there a lecturer or tutor you think did a fantastic job this year?
The Excellence in Teaching Awards are a way of recognising and rewarding outstanding teaching within the Faculty, whether this be on campus, in research, in practice or in placements.
It is an opportunity to acknowledge those teachers who make a real difference to the learning experience of our students.
